Understanding Valencia Airport Taxi Fares

Taxi fares in Valencia, much like in other Spanish cities, are typically regulated and can vary based on several factors. It’s crucial to be aware of these elements to avoid surprises and to better gauge what constitutes a 'good price'.

  • Metered Fares: Standard taxis from the airport rank operate on a meter. The final price depends on the distance travelled, the time of day, and any potential surcharges.
  • Airport Surcharge: It's common for airports to have a specific surcharge added to the fare for pickups from the terminal. This is a standard fee and not something you can avoid by choosing a different taxi from the rank.
  • Night and Weekend Rates: Taxis generally operate on different tariffs for daytime, nighttime, weekends, and public holidays. Night and weekend rates are typically higher, so if your flight arrives during these periods, expect a slightly increased fare.
  • Luggage: While standard luggage is usually included, excessively large or numerous items might incur a small additional fee. Always clarify if you have unusual luggage requirements.
  • Tolls: Although less common for direct airport transfers within Valencia city, journeys to further destinations might involve motorway tolls, which would be added to your fare.

Being aware of these factors helps you understand why prices might fluctuate and sets realistic expectations for your journey.

2. Airport Taxi Ranks

Upon exiting the terminal, you'll find designated taxi ranks where official taxis queue for passengers. This is the traditional way to hail a taxi.

  • Availability: Taxis are usually readily available, especially during peak hours, though there can be queues at very busy times.
  • Metered Fares: As mentioned, these taxis operate on a meter, so the final price is determined by the distance and time taken. While this is transparent, it means the price can fluctuate depending on traffic conditions.
  • No Prior Arrangement: You don't need to book in advance, offering spontaneity, but also less certainty regarding the fare.
  • Potential for Language Barrier: While many drivers speak some English, clear communication about your destination might occasionally be a challenge, though less so in a major tourist hub like Valencia.

3. Ride-Hailing Apps (e.g., Uber, Bolt)

If available and operational in Valencia (their presence and regulations can change), ride-hailing apps offer an alternative.

  • Price Estimates: These apps provide an estimated fare upfront, which can be helpful for budgeting.
  • Dynamic Pricing: Be aware of 'surge pricing' during high demand (e.g., peak hours, bad weather, special events), which can significantly increase fares, sometimes making them more expensive than traditional taxis or pre-booked services.
  • Convenience: Booking is done via an app, and you can track your driver's location.
  • Pickup Points: Sometimes designated pickup points at airports can be a bit of a walk from the terminal.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Here are some common questions travellers have about booking taxis from Valencia Airport:

Q: Is it cheaper to pre-book a taxi from Valencia Airport?
A: Often, yes, especially for a fixed price that includes all potential surcharges. Pre-booking allows you to compare quotes and lock in a rate, which can be more cost-effective than a metered fare that might increase due to traffic or night tariffs.

Q: How much luggage can I bring in a Valencia taxi?
A: Standard taxis accommodate typical luggage for 3-4 passengers. If you have oversized items (e.g., surfboards, multiple large suitcases) or are a larger group, it's best to specify this when booking to ensure a suitable vehicle (like a minivan) is provided, potentially for an additional small fee.

Q: What if my flight is delayed? Will I be charged extra?
A: With reputable pre-booked private transfer services, drivers monitor flight arrivals and adjust their pickup time accordingly. They typically won't charge extra for reasonable flight delays. Always confirm this policy when booking.

Q: Can I pay by card in Valencia taxis?
A: Most official taxis in Valencia accept card payments, but it's always advisable to carry some euros for smaller payments or as a backup, just in case. Pre-booked services often allow you to pay online in advance, which is very convenient.

Q: Are there taxis available 24/7 at Valencia Airport?
A: Yes, taxis are available around the clock at Valencia Airport, catering to all flight schedules. However, be aware that night rates apply during specific hours (usually from 10 PM to 6 AM) and on weekends/public holidays.

Q: How far is Valencia Airport from the city centre?
A: Valencia Airport (VLC) is located approximately 8 kilometres (5 miles) west of the city centre. A taxi ride typically takes between 15-25 minutes, depending on traffic and your exact destination within the city.
